MySQL数据库项目实战本资源摘要信息涵盖了MySQL数据库项目实战的主要知识点,包括数据库设计SQL语句编写数据库管理和操作技术等方面。一、数据库设计:数据库设计的基本目的是建立一个学生信息管理数据库,包括学生信息、课程信息、成绩信息和教师信息等多个方面。数据库设计的主要步骤包括创建数据库、创建数据表、设计表结构、定义主键和外键等。本设计中,创建了五个数据表,包括学生信息表、课程信息表、成绩信息表、教师信息表和授课信息表。二、SQL语句编写:在本设计中,使用了多种SQL语句,包括CREATE DATABASE、CREATE TABLE、ALTER TABLE、INSERT INTO、SELECT、UPDATE和DELETE等。例如,在创建学生信息表时,使用了以下SQL语句:

CREATE TABLE student(
 sno char(10) not null,
 sname varchar(8),
 ssex char(3),
 birthday datetime,
 saddress varchar(50),
 sdept char(16),
 speciality varchar(20),
 CONSTRAINT pk01 PRIMARY key (sno)
 ); 

在插入数据时,使用了INSERT INTO语句,例如: